Description

Pedro de Peralta Barnuevo (1664–1743), a writer of early eighteenth-century viceregal Peru, believed that his epic poem Lima fundada (1732), in tandem with Historia de España vindicada (1730), was his crowning literary achievement. His instincts have proven correct. However, in spite of the fact that Lima fundada is Peralta’s most cited work, it has not been published in its entirety since it appeared. For the first time in more than 280 years, David F. Slade and Jerry W. Williams have edited the entire poem, including all of its original paratexts, introductory compositions, prologue,footnotes, marginal notes and index. Lima fundada by Pedro de Peralta Barnuevo: A Critical Edition recounts the founding of Peru’s capital city by Fernando Pizarro, a hero that gives shape to a conflicted discourse about colonization and empire. Lima fundada is implicitly about criollo identity, history, and power in the face of a hierarchical system that gives preference tothe Peninsular-born. The text is a complex history of the conquest in which a cast of nations, empires, rulers, and peoples join to create Peralta’s vision of Peru, while celebrating creoles as the true inheritors of the city’s heroic founding.

Author Biography:

David F. Slade is associate professor of Spanish and chairpersonof the Department of Foreign Languages at Berry College. Jerry M. Williams is professor of Spanish and chairpersonof the Department of Languages and Cultures at West Chester University. Slade and Williams coedited Bajo el Cielo Peruano: The Devout World of Peralta Barnuevo.
